After years of speculation, we finally know what Google’s first internal smartwatch will be called. Surprisingly to no one, a new trademark filed with the U.S. Patent and Trademark Office reveals that it’s … Pixel Watch.
Submitting (via Google 9to5) is as simple as it gets. The description says that the name of the Pixel Watch is “designed to cover the categories of smart watches; Cases adapted for holding smart watches; Wearable computers in the nature of smart watches; smart watch straps; Smart watch bands. “The documentation goes on to say that while the Pixel Watch name is not currently in use, it is intended to be used. The name signals Google’s intention to carry the device as a companion to its Pixel phones Pixel brand Image: USPTO
Of course, this name was completely expected, even if it was a bit anticlimactic. Technical media have for years referred to the concept of a smart watch Made by Google as Pixel Watch. It also makes sense when you consider that Big Tech uses smart watches to improve its ecosystems. Calling it the Pixel Watch, Google has signaled its intention to use the wearable device as a companion to its Pixel phones. And if that attracts more people to the web of Google widgets and services … Well, that was the plan all along.
We already have a pretty good idea of what to expect. The news that Google will finally make the Pixel Watch real broke in December and there were several leaks in renders and dials. Google has also been expected for a long time to annoy Pixel Watch on Google I / O next month – which the timing of this brand’s release is strongly supported. The Pixel Watch is also expected to include some integration of Fitbit with Wear OS 3. The smartwatch is also expected to cost more than Fitbit and serve as a direct competitor to the Apple Watch.
